Concrete Foundation Repair in North Andover, MA
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as fixing cracks, addressing settlement or sinking, and reinforcing or stabilizing foundations affected by shifting soil, moisture changes, or aging materials. Homeowners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ls and concrete slabs, aiming to prevent further structural damage and maintain the safety of their property.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the underlying causes, and the best methods for stabilization or restoration. It is important to assess whether repairs are sufficient or if more extensive solutions are needed to ensure long-term stability. Clear communication about the scope of work, potential impacts on the property, and the expected outcomes can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ining the safety and value of their homes.

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s
Cracked or uneven basement floors - repairs restore stability and prevent further damage.
Settling foundation issues - stabilization methods help maintain the structure’s integrity.
Foundation wall bowing or cracking - repairs reinforce and prevent wall collapse or further movement.
Leaking or moisture-damaged foundations - sealing and waterproofing protect against water intrusion.
Concrete slab foundation problems - lifting and leveling services address sinking or uneven slabs.
Foundation reinforcement for new or existing structures - strengthening work supports long-term stability.
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ation.
What types of foundation repair are available?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ization to address different types of issues.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but it's important to have an assessment to determine if further action is needed.
